#d111cf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d111cf is composed of 82% red, 6.7%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.9% magenta, 1%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 300.6 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 44.3%. #d111cf color hex could be obtained by blending #ff22ff with #a3009f.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

Shades and Tints of #d111cf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090109 is the darkest color, while #fef6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d111cf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717171 is the less saturated color, while #da08d8 is the most saturated one.
